PEP GUARDIOLA sent a cheeky message of support to West Ham as his team closed the gap on Arsenal to two points. The Manchester City boss crossed his arms to make the Hammers sign and said “come on you Irons” before hilariously running out of his press conference. Mikel Arteta’s men go to London Stadium…
